Banks Lake South
Hamlet
Banks Lake South is a census-designated place in Grant County, Washington, United States. The population was 234 at the 2020 census. Banks Lake South is situated 5 miles northwest of Schell Dam.
Coulee City
Photo: Publichall, Public domain.
Coulee City is in the Columbia River Plateau of Washington State, at the south shore of Banks Lake in the Grand Coulee.
